Definitions for the HealthInterventionsSource logical model.
Guidance on how to interpret the contents of this table can be foundhere
| 0. HealthInterventionsSource | |
| Definition | Source reference for Health Interventions - exactly one of the following must be provided:
|
| Short | Health Interventions Source |
| Control | 0..* |
| Is Modifier | false |
| Logical Model | Instances of this logical model are not marked to be the target of a Reference |
| 2. HealthInterventionsSource.url | |
| Definition | URL to retrieve HealthInterventions definition from input/ or external source |
| Short | URL |
| Control | 0..1 |
| Type | url |
| Primitive Value | This primitive element may be present, or absent, or replaced by an extension |
| 4. HealthInterventionsSource.canonical | |
| Definition | Canonical URI pointing to the HealthInterventions definition |
| Short | Canonical |
| Control | 0..1 |
| Type | canonical(Health Interventions and Recommendations (DAK)) |
| Primitive Value | This primitive element may be present, or absent, or replaced by an extension |
| 6. HealthInterventionsSource.instance | |
| Definition | Inline HealthInterventions instance data |
| Short | Instance |
| Control | 0..1 |
| Type | http://smart.who.int/base/StructureDefinition/HealthInterventions |
